Chung Hwa victorious in Maths competition
By James Kon


Students at the examination hall 

Sweeping away the individual and team events of the 3rd annual Non-government Primary School Mathematics Competition 2003 yesterday morning, Chung Hwa Middle School have done themselves proud once again! Conducted at the Chung Hwa Middle School hall, 178 students took part in the competition.

"The top score for this year's competition is 118, as compared to last year with 96," Madam Kho, the principal of Chung Hwa Middle School announced during the prize presentation ceremony. "There has been a vast improvement in both the quality and quantity of overall students' performance."

"The learning of Mathematics and Science is a 'crossroad', where new and innovation ideas are generated," she pointed out.

"With an increasing reliance on computers, growing globalisation in both business and information technologies, greater demands are placed on both schools and students. We need to meet these challenges if we are to maintain our 'pre-eminence' in these areas in the 21st Century," she went on to say.

The first three spots of the individual Mathematics Competition went to Chung Hwa Middle School's Andrew Koay Yi Jie, Sia Tze Hung and Lawrance Lim Yin Jun respectively. Chung Hwa Middle School also emerged victorious in the team category.
